It’s all over the trades this morning….
Toshiba introducing "no glasses required 3D".

Before you get too excited 

  • The technology is only going to be available in Japan at this time.
  • The technology is not scheduled to ship in Japan until December.
  • The technology is based on the Cell processor technology.
  • The Cell processor technology is extremely expensive making it cost prohibitive in the US market.
  • The technology is really only being featured on small screen product in Asia. Not the big the home theater TVs that do better in the US.

As a side note

At the recent Toshiba dealer trip, Scott Ramirez, VP of Television Marketing for Toshiba, explained that glasses free 3D TV in the US would likely not be available until a new technology called 2K-4K is available for mass production. The 2K-4K prototypes do have some issues with viewing angles of 3D. His estimation was it would likely be late 2011, at best, before any glasses free 3D product would be available in the US. The 2K-4K technology comes at a price premium 3x 4x higher than current retail 3D price levels. Between now and then, the technology focus is really on passive 3D technology, which still requires glasses, but the glasses are more like the Ray Ban glasses you get in the theater.

Of course, technology in this industry and product plans in this industry change faster than the weather in Iowa. So, anything could be possible, but the above gives you a general guidance of where Toshiba thinks things are headed as of today.
